Embracing Ancient Elegance: A Step-by-Step Guide to Making a Toga

A toga, the iconic garment of ancient Greece and Rome, exudes an aura of sophistication and refinement. Creating a toga is a fun and rewarding project that can be completed with a few simple materials and some basic sewing skills. In this comprehensive guide, we'll walk you through the process of making a traditional toga, from gathering materials to donning your finished garment.

Gathering Materials

To make a toga, you'll need the following materials:

  • 2 yards of cotton or linen fabric (white or off-white preferred)
  • Thread (matching the color of the fabric)
  • Scissors
  • Sewing needles (sharp and heavy-duty)
  • Toga pins or brooches (optional)

Designing Your Toga

A traditional toga is characterized by a simple, draped design. Before you start sewing, take some time to plan out your toga's design. Consider the following factors:

  • Length: How long do you want your toga to be? Traditional togas typically fall to the knees or ankles.
  • Width: How wide do you want your toga to be? A good starting point is about 2-3 times the width of your body.
  • Neckline: Do you want a simple, straight neckline or a more ornate design?
  • Decorations: Will you add any embellishments, such as laurel leaves or ribbons?

Step 1: Cutting Out Your Fabric

Using your design as a guide, cut out two rectangular pieces of fabric from your 2-yard supply. Make sure the fabric is folded in half lengthwise before cutting to ensure symmetry.

Step 2: Hemming the Edges

Using a 1/4-inch seam allowance, fold the raw edges of the fabric over twice to create a hem. Pin in place and sew along the folded edge to secure. Repeat for the second piece of fabric.

Step 3: Sewing the Toga Together

Place the two pieces of fabric right sides together (meaning the wrong sides are facing out) and sew along the top and side edges, leaving a small opening for turning the toga right side out.

Step 4: Turning and Pressing the Toga

Carefully turn the toga right side out through the small opening and press the seams flat using a hot iron.

Step 5: Adding a Brooch or Toga Pin

If desired, attach a brooch or toga pin to the top of the toga to secure it in place. This is a nice touch for a more authentic look.

Step 6: Wearing Your Toga with Pride

Finally, try on your finished toga and adjust the fit as needed. You can also add some finishing touches, such as a laurel wreath or a ribbon belt, to complete the ancient Greek or Roman look.

Tips and Variations

Here are a few tips and variations to keep in mind:

  • Use a lightweight fabric for a more comfortable toga.
  • Add some texture or pattern to the fabric for a more interesting look.
  • Experiment with different neckline styles or add some decorative trim.
  • Try making a toga for a special occasion, such as a costume party or historical reenactment.
